Dr. David Yeh, M.D.
What this data tells you about Dr. Yeh
Dr. David Yeh is a neurological surgery specialist in San Jose, CA, with 19 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Yeh performed 825 Medicare services across 647 unique beneficiaries.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Yeh received a total of $33,021 from 17 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 70 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in neurological surgery. The majority of payments are for consulting, which typically reflects recognized clinical expertise sought by manufacturers.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.
